SigmundHas anyone ordered from Retro Rifles out of Reno NV?
https://retrorifles.com/A pal back east just had a bad experience, I'm wondering if that's common or just a one-time thing. He used his credit card to order a flash hider, sling, and some lock washers and the card was charged immediately. After waiting a reasonable amount of time, he sent a polite status check email to the company. No reply. Another wait, he sent a second and then a THIRD email. Nothing.
He considered calling them on the phone, but based on the conduct he'd already experienced he had no-reason to trust any verbal assurances they may have given him, and thus wanted to keep any communication in-writing. He then called his CC to protest the order and – Golly, Sergeant Carter - he got an email they're being shipped. No explanation or apology, just a shipping notice. They have not yet arrived, but it seems RR only got the message when payment was stopped.
Has anyone had a good or bad experience with Retro Rifles?
